Dieting is not just about cutting your food – it is all about eating the right proportion of food combined with regular exercise.

So what exactly is dieting?

 

Dieting is healthy intake of food as per your weight combined with a regular exercise. The basic aim is to reduce your weight and maintain it. There is this funda about your BMI (body-mass-index) – I won’t get into this funda because I have no knowledge on that.

How does one diet effectively?

Following are some basic Dos and Don’ts on dieting.

Don’ts

1) Never skip your breakfast even though you have had a heavy meal the previous night.

2) Never eat more than your capacity.

3) Avoid fattening food like mayonnaise, cheese, deep fried stuff and red meat if possible.

4) Avoid over-eating or under-eating.

Do’s:

1) Exercise regularly – at least thrice a week. If that is not possible then go for jogs or brisk walks.

2) Have fresh fruit juices everyday.

3) Maintain a balanced diet.

The exact ratio for toning down your body is 30% exercise and 70% dieting. Again, by dieting I do not mean cutting down on your food but a proper and balanced diet.
